Visy Champions Sustainability and Innovation at QMCA Awards

Ahead of this Friday’s QMCA Awards, Iain Harris, Executive General Manager of Operational Excellence at Visy, has underscored the importance of the Queensland Major Contractors Association (QMCA) awards to their organisation, highlighting the symbiotic relationship between Visy and the construction industry.

“Queensland’s construction industry makes a significant contribution to the economy and sustainability of the state,” Iain stated. “The QMCA awards provide Visy with an opportunity to partner with this vibrant and innovative sector, aligning with our long-standing commitment to sustainability and investing in the economic future of regional communities.”

“With over half a billion dollars’ worth of investment currently under construction in the state, Visy has firsthand experience of the industry’s continuous delivery of excellent projects and solutions for Queenslanders.”

He pointed to Visy’s own collaboration with the sector, exemplified by their $2 billion investment commitment to transform recycling and remanufacturing in Australia, with $700 million earmarked for Queensland alone. As an example, Iain mentioned the construction of their new glass recycling and remanufacturing super site in Stapylton, just south of Brisbane.
